Monetary Policy Week in Review - 26 May 2012
The past week in monetary policy saw 9 central banks reviewing interest rate settings. Three central banks reduced their monetary policy interest rates: Vietnam cut another -100 basis points to 12.00%, Denmark trimmed -10 basis points to 0.60%,

Venezuela's oil basket tumbles again; hits USD 101.63 per barrel
The Venezuelan crude oil continued its downward trend, amid an oil market hit by bad signs for the global economy. The Venezuelan oil basket dropped USD 3.03 this week compared to last week s average and ended at USD 101.63 per barrel during the week ...
